Output d50896fbf989b6e3a6b901a3d993f39fcf2cbb3bb7e2bc3d3679f8ba28edbdca:0

value
25273631
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12c5031101796506e1899043f721f9e9fff8a6fa OP_EQUALVERIFY OP_CHECKSIG
address
12iFB5wXLa2Bwr9KaWKMUT85c5pRd8ZgA3
transaction
d50896fbf989b6e3a6b901a3d993f39fcf2cbb3bb7e2bc3d3679f8ba28edbdca
confirmations
516292
spent
true